CHAPTER 169-C
CHILD PROTECTION ACT

Section 169-C:19-d

    169-C:19-d Siblings. –
I. The department shall place a child with the child's siblings unless doing so would be harmful to the child or siblings, or otherwise not in the child's best interest.
II. If siblings are not placed together, reasonable efforts shall be made to provide for visitation with siblings, unless such visitation would be harmful to the child or sibling.

Source. 1998, 203:2, eff. June 18, 1998. 2024, 377:2, eff. Jan. 1, 2025.
